A manager states that her process is really working well. out of 1,500 parts, 1,477 were produced free of a particular defect and passed inspection. based upon six sigma theory, how would you rate this performance, other things being equal?

Six sigma is a philosophy and set of methods companies use to eliminate defects in their products and processes
. It also seeks to reduce variation in the processes that lead to product defects. It measures quality, process for Continuous Improvement and enabler for culture change so culturally six sigma means companies must learn how to be nearly flawless in executing key processes and achieving business imperatives. Quantitatively six sigma means the average process generates no more than 3.4 defects per million. Therefore, based on the figures given above the defects per million opportunities (DPMO) is 15, 333 and the defective rate us 1.533% and the passed rate is 98.467%.
